Open Cosmos, founded in 2015, is a space company that designs, builds, launches, and operates satellites, with a focus on simplifying access to space and democratizing space data. It provides end-to-end mission services, including satellite assembly, launch campaigns, in-orbit operations, and data delivery, enabling organizations to utilize satellite imagery for Earth observation and address global challenges. Open Cosmos works with partners like the European Space Agency (ESA) and collaborates with organizations such as Space Park Leicester to expand its capabilities and data exploitation reach. The company's key services include its OpenOrbit mission management, OpenConstellation infrastructure for data sharing, and DataCosmos platform for AI-powered data analysis.

Open Cosmos has 10 missions under development, including the MANTIS mission in partnership with ESA-Incubed and the UK Space Agency, which aims to provide high-resolution imagery and IOD6 in partnership with the Satellite Applications Catapult.
Open Cosmos has invested more than £4 million in research and development, leveraged with support from the UK Space Agency and the European Space Agency through the ARTES Partnership Project; Pioneer programme, and has grown its team from five to 50 people.
Open Cosmos launched two commercial smallsats that were entirely created at its Harwell Campus headquarters in the United Kingdom on Monday, 2021-03-22.
The two Open Cosmos nanosatellites were launched aboard a Soyuz-2 rocket from the Baikonur Cosmodrome alongside the South Korean Earth observation satellite CAS500-1 and about 30 other satellites.

Open Cosmos sealed a deal with satellite communications operator Sateliot to build and operate Sateliot’s nanosatellite constellation.
Sateliot selected Open Cosmos on 2020-07-28 to build and operate a constellation of up to 100 small satellites but did not sign a firm contract for the full system.
Open Cosmos is arranging launches, ground station communications, and insurance for Sateliot and will operate the satellites in addition to building them.
Open Cosmos anticipates receiving manufacturing orders from Sateliot in phases rather than as a bulk order for 100 satellites.
Open Cosmos builds cubesats and smallsats up to 50 kg and focuses its business model on turnkey solutions for customers.
